Give us a brief introduction to your organisation and the role it plays in the radio sector

Gsertel develops measurement and monitoring technologies for the broadcast industry, supporting both digital radio and television operators. Our focus is on delivering reliable test and monitoring solutions combined with continuous product development and customer support, helping broadcasters ensure the highest quality of service.

What DAB+ products or services are you showcasing at IBC2026?

At IBC2026, we will be showcasing RCS Radio, our newest monitoring platform. RCS Radio brings together advanced DAB monitoring and FM monitoring capabilities within a single unit, simplifying infrastructure requirements and reducing operational complexity.

By combining multiple monitoring functions in a cost-effective solution, broadcasters gain greater flexibility in how they deploy and manage their monitoring networks while maintaining a comprehensive view of service quality and performance across both digital and analogue radio services.
